Emerging Technologies Revolutionizing Online Gambling
Technology continues to be the cornerstone of innovation in the iGaming sector. Several key developments are transforming how players interact with games and how operators deliver content.
- Artificial Intelligence (AI): AI algorithms personalize gaming experiences by analyzing player behavior, offering tailored game recommendations, and enhancing fraud detection.
- Virtual Reality (VR) and Augmented Reality (AR): Immersive environments are becoming more accessible, allowing players to engage in realistic casino settings from their homes.
- Blockchain and Cryptocurrencies: Decentralized ledgers ensure transparency and security, while cryptocurrencies offer new payment options with faster transactions and anonymity.
- Mobile Gaming: With over 60% of online gambling traffic coming from mobile devices, operators are optimizing platforms for seamless mobile experiences.
Regulatory Developments and Their Impact
The regulatory framework governing online gambling is continuously evolving, influencing market accessibility and player protection measures worldwide.
| Region | New Regulations | Impact on Operators | Player Benefits |
|---|---|---|---|
| Europe | Stricter advertising rules and mandatory self-exclusion tools | Increased compliance costs but improved brand trust | Enhanced protection against gambling addiction |
| North America | Expansion of legalized sports betting in multiple states | New market opportunities and partnerships | Greater variety of betting options and promotions |
| Asia-Pacific | Introduction of licensing regimes in emerging markets | Entry barriers for unregulated operators | Safer and more regulated gaming environments |
Strategies for Responsible Gambling in the Digital Age
As online gambling becomes more accessible, promoting responsible gaming practices is paramount. Operators and regulators are implementing various strategies to safeguard players.
- Self-Exclusion Programs: Allowing players to voluntarily restrict access to gambling platforms for specified periods.
- Deposit and Bet Limits: Tools enabling users to set financial boundaries to control spending.
- Real-Time Monitoring: AI-powered systems detect risky behavior and intervene when necessary.
- Educational Resources: Providing information on gambling risks and support options.
Comparing Popular Online Casino Games in 2024
The diversity of online casino games continues to expand, catering to a wide range of player preferences. Below is a comparison of some of the most popular game types based on RTP (Return to Player), volatility, and player engagement.
| Game Type | Average RTP | Volatility | Player Appeal |
|---|---|---|---|
| Video Slots | 95% – 97% | Low to High | High – Variety of themes and bonus features |
| Live Dealer Games | 97% – 99% | Medium | High – Real-time interaction with dealers |
| Table Games (Blackjack, Roulette) | 98% – 99.5% | Low to Medium | Medium – Strategic gameplay |
| Sports Betting | Varies | Varies | High – Wide range of sports and events |
